Boston and Manchester, 1872. Boston and Manchester: 1872.

Three Autograph Letters Signed ("R.H. Dana Jr" and "R.H.D. Jr"), 18 pp. recto and verso, (conjoined leaves). Octavo. Boston and Manchester, 1872-1874, to his daughter, Elizabeth Ellery Dana. Lengthy and affectionate letters full of family gossip, advice, and details of his travel. Written in brown ink on Dana's personal stationary. Fine.

Elizabeth Ellery Dana (1846-1939), the eldest of seven children, had two brothers, William and Edmund Trowbridge, and three sisters, Lucy (wife of William Channing), Ann, and Almy (later married to William Stedman). She also had several quite young half-brothers and sisters.
